Phalaenopsis Tiny Teardrops

Phalaenopsis Tiny Teardrops, an orchid hybrid, is the offspring of the cross between Phalaenopsis Mancini and Phalaenopsis equestris.

Orchid Genera:

Parentage:

Phalaenopsis equestris (50%)
Phalaenopsis aphrodite (12.28%)
Phalaenopsis amabilis (12.06%)
Phalaenopsis schilleriana (11.52%)
Phalaenopsis stuartiana (8.11%)
Phalaenopsis rimestadiana (4.27%)
Phalaenopsis sanderiana (1.76%)
